How does one go about changing the filters with out changing the hy fluid?
It seems this would be a huge mess when taking the filters off. Or is it a matter of draining the fluid first in to a bucket or two.

Some folks have been successful at using a vacuum cleaner on the fill port. I imagine you would have to plug the vent as well.

When I changed the hydraulic filter on my tractor, I just drained everything and then filtered it when putting it back in.

On my Case DX 40 all I did was spin off the old filter and put on a new one at the 50 hour service only lost the oil in the filter just had to add a small amount.
